What is Zinnia elegans ‘Salmon Queen’?

Zinnia elegans 'Salmon Queen'

Advertisement

Zinnia elegans, commonly known as youth-and-old-age or elegant zinnia, is a species of annual flowering plant in the daisy family, Asteraceae. ‘Salmon Queen’ is a specific variety known for its stunning salmon-colored blooms, adding a vibrant touch to any garden or landscape. This cultivar has gained popularity for its resilient nature and attractive appearance, making it a favorite among gardeners and floral enthusiasts.

Water

Proper watering is crucial for the healthy growth and blooming of Zinnia elegans ‘Salmon Queen’. Consider the following watering guidelines:
Regular Watering: Provide consistent moisture, especially during dry periods, to promote continuous blooming and robust plant growth.
Avoid Overwatering: While adequate moisture is essential, ensure that the soil is well-draining to prevent waterlogging, which can lead to root rot.

Sunlight

Zinnia elegans ‘Salmon Queen’ thrives in sunny conditions and requires ample sunlight to flourish. Consider the following sunlight requirements:
Full Sun Exposure: Plant ‘Salmon Queen’ zinnias in areas that receive at least 6-8 hours of direct sunlight daily for optimal growth and abundant flowering.

Fertilizer

Applying a balanced fertilizer can enhance the overall health and blooming capacity of Zinnia elegans ‘Salmon Queen’. Follow these fertilizer recommendations:
Regular Feeding: Use a well-balanced, water-soluble fertilizer every 3-4 weeks during the growing season to provide essential nutrients for robust growth and prolific blooms.
Avoid Overfeeding: While fertilization is beneficial, refrain from excessive feeding, as it can lead to excessive foliage growth at the expense of flowering.

Soil

Selecting the right soil type and quality is crucial for the successful cultivation of Zinnia elegans ‘Salmon Queen’. Consider the following soil requirements:
Well-Drained Soil: Plant ‘Salmon Queen’ zinnias in loamy, well-draining soil to prevent water accumulation around the roots.
Soil pH: Aim for a slightly acidic to neutral pH (6.0-7.5) for optimal nutrient uptake and overall plant health.

Pruning

Pruning plays a significant role in promoting healthy growth and prolonging the blooming period of Zinnia elegans ‘Salmon Queen’. Follow these pruning tips:
Deadheading: Remove spent blooms regularly to stimulate the production of new flowers and maintain a tidy appearance.
Avoid Excessive Pruning: While deadheading is beneficial, avoid excessive pruning, as it can hinder the plant’s ability to photosynthesize and produce energy.

Container Common Diseases

When growing Zinnia elegans ‘Salmon Queen’ in containers, it is essential to be mindful of potential diseases that may affect the plants. Common container diseases include:
Powdery Mildew: This fungal disease can manifest as a powdery white coating on the foliage, often due to high humidity and poor air circulation.
Botrytis Blight: Wet and humid conditions can lead to botrytis blight, causing brown spots and mold growth on the leaves and flowers.

Disease Diagnosis

Diagnosing and addressing diseases promptly is crucial for preserving the health and vigor of Zinnia elegans ‘Salmon Queen’ in containers. Look out for the following symptoms:
Foliage Discoloration: Yellowing or browning of the leaves can indicate various fungal or bacterial diseases that require immediate attention.
Abnormal Growth: Stunted growth, distorted foliage, and wilting can be signs of underlying diseases that need to be addressed.

Common Pests

Container-grown Zinnia elegans ‘Salmon Queen’ may be susceptible to pest infestations that can compromise plant health. Common pests include:
Aphids: These tiny insects can cluster on the tender growth tips and underside of leaves, causing damage and potentially transmitting viruses.
Spider Mites: Warm and dry conditions can favor spider mite infestations, leading to stippled and discolored foliage.
